Case Against Meta Likely Moving Forward After Court Heard Dismissal Arguments
A federal judge said he is inclined to let proceed a putative class action lawsuit against Meta over its gathering of data from medical center patient portals through a web activity tracking tool. U.S. District for the District of Northern California Judge William Orrick on heard arguments.
